Recalling the Archbishop’s strained expression while giving the blessing, Viare worried he might have noticed her power, but she quickly shook her head.

The ‘Eye of Truth’ was known only to her mother, the Duchess, and Viare herself.

Even tracing back the lineage of those who possessed the power, including her maternal grandmother, everyone had long since passed away.

Noticing the attention of other believers, Viare merely smiled slightly in response to their questions, offering no answer.

Feeling increasingly fatigued due to the time spent, she longed to return and rest.

Having prepared since early dawn for her visit to the Grand Temple, she felt overwhelmed with sleepiness.

She had deliberately chosen a less busy time to visit, but contrary to her expectations, there were many people attending the morning mass.

Regretting not having slept in and visited in the late afternoon, Viare hurried her steps.

It would take about two hours to reach the mansion, and as she walked through the long corridors and reached a less crowded path, she heard a deep, resonant voice.

“Why is the Lady here?”

Startled, Viare looked up towards the source of the sound, wondering if perhaps she shouldn’t have ventured out today.

With everything seemingly going awry, she sighed and respectfully addressed the man standing before her.

“Holy glory to the Marta Empire.”

The light-blond-haired, red-eyed man looked amused, as if he had found an interesting toy, his slick lips curling up.

“What need for formality between us?”

Despite his playful tone, Viare felt discomfort under his scrutinizing gaze.

‘Ivan Rio Cartos’

He was the sole Crown Prince of the Marta Empire, designated as the next Emperor, whom no one dared defy.

Viare had first met Ivan when she was ten, excitedly holding her father’s hand during a visit to the palace.

Ivan, two years her senior, appeared unusually mature for his age, quick-witted and adept in any situation. But Viare did not take a liking to him, especially since he seemed to enjoy teasing her whenever they met.

His arrogance and manipulation behind the scenes, even deceiving adults, made her dislike him even more.

When there were talks of marriage between them, Viare went as far as to stage a hunger strike, crying and refusing to eat until her father called off the arrangement.

Since then, Viare avoided events he attended, and fortunately, he was on the southern front during her debutante ball.

Having secured a strong political standing and the support of his base with his victory, Ivan’s political demeanor was impeccable.

He was known for his relief work and increasing public favor, making him an ideal candidate for the next Emperor.

His handsome appearance and tall stature attracted many admirers, something Viare was aware of.

‘If only that was all there was to it.’

His reputation for having a new woman leave his bedroom every morning was no exaggeration. His crude behavior, even in broad daylight, only added to his notoriety.

It was a wonder he had no illegitimate children to date, but the Crown Prince was not someone to create a situation detrimental to himself.
If a woman appeared claiming to have his child, Ivan would not hesitate to eliminate her on the spot. Before the regression, an incident had occurred where the empire was upended by a lady claiming to have the Crown Prince’s illegitimate child, and Ivan had secretly killed them both.

Viare had no desire to encounter him and thus had not ventured near the royal palace, making this meeting the first since then. She pushed aside her fleeting thoughts and bowed slightly, replying politely.

“I was about to deliver a donation.”

“Aha, so that’s why the Duke was not present.”

Upon realizing he had been looking for her father, Viare raised her eyebrows slightly and observed Ivan. Even though the Duke of Ruschev was a loyal serpent to the Emperor, he hadn’t sworn allegiance to the Crown Prince.

Viare’s unexpected frown caught Ivan’s persistent gaze.

“Is there a need to be so surprised? You already know, don’t you?”

“I’m not sure what you mean,” she responded.

“Hmm, it seems the Duke hasn’t informed you yet.”

Ivan chuckled at her displeased expression and started the conversation.

“The lady will be an adult next year, right?”

“Yes, Your Highness.”

“Then let’s do it then.”

Frustrated by the man’s uncommunicative nature, Viare sighed inwardly.

She tried to grasp Ivan’s intentions, but understanding his rhetoric seemed futile and vain.

Seemingly amused by the situation, Ivan smiled broadly and slowly approached her. Surprised by his unexpected behavior, Viare instinctively stepped back.

Checking his surroundings as if ensuring secrecy, Ivan whispered just audibly to Viare.

“It’s about our engagement.”

Viare wasn’t here to waste time on such absurdity. She sighed lightly and glared coldly at Ivan.

“Please stop with the baseless jokes.”

“Why? Planning another hunger strike like before?”

Her childhood actions hadn’t remained hidden within the duke’s manor; the royal court knew too.

If Ivan felt his pride was hurt, Viare was willing to apologize repeatedly.

“I sincerely apologize for that incident.”

“Do you really think I’ve been resentful about that to this day?”

Viare just looked at him indifferently, prompting a low chuckle from Ivan.

“Huh, how badly do you think of me?”

In Viare’s mind, he was already trash, but she had no intention of revealing that.

When she simply stared at Ivan without reacting, he awkwardly added, “I can’t marry a prince, can I?”

Among the four major ducal families of the Marta Empire, only the Ruschev Duke had a daughter. Ivan likely aimed to solidify his power by marrying into her family.

He seemed contemplative, then added with a grimace.

“I despise illegitimate children. I don’t want an adopted daughter either.”

Considering his behavior with other women, Viare almost laughed at the irony.

“Have you already concluded your discussion with my father?”

“Who do you think was most pleased when I mentioned this?”
“Have you already finished discussing this with my father?”

“When I mentioned this matter, who do you think was most pleased?”

Ivan seemed triumphant, as if he had concluded all discussions with the Duke. The Duke’s eagerness to pair her off with Ivan felt like a massive betrayal to Viare. She had always despised the greed of nobles who, knowing what kind of person the Crown Prince was, still tried to attach their daughters to him.

Viare felt a surge of anger while looking at Ivan, who displayed arrogance without understanding her thoughts.

“My opinion wasn’t considered, was it?”

His relaxed smile towards her made it seem as if her wishes were of no importance.

“Oh dear, you’re still too young to understand.”

“Yes, and therefore I lack the charm to entertain Your Highness day and night.”

“…….”

“Though I doubt I’ll ever understand it.”

Viare’s lips held a bitter smile while responding to Ivan. Surely, the perceptive Crown Prince would not fail to grasp her words.

Ivan, gradually losing his smile and adopting a serious expression, suddenly grabbed her waist and pulled her close.

“It would be better for you to stop playing hard to get, Lady.”

Viare struggled to free herself from Ivan’s grip, but the more she tried, the tighter his hold became. The playful side of Ivan had long vanished, only his threatening red eyes focusing on her blue-green ones.

“It would be better if you let me go now.”

As Viare glared at him with eyes turning red from exertion, Ivan let go of her with an irrepressible chuckle.

“It’s best to seize the opportunity when it comes.”

Whistling, he casually passed her and headed towards his original destination.

Viare, still trying to comprehend what had just happened, could only watch as he walked away. Once he was out of sight, the tension dissipated, and she collapsed, trembling. Realizing her powerlessness in the face of Ivan’s dominance, she felt enraged at her own weakness.

“Damn… This is awful.”

Recounting the humiliation she just endured, Viare resolved not to let things go his way anymore.
